  • Abstract
    Digital Home (DH) offers a lot of business opportunities. Therefore, DH is a place to be for industrialists such as Telecommunications Operators, Services Providers, Network, Devices and Consumer Electronics Manufacturers. DH raises many challenges about, among others, Management (i.e., Configuration and Deployment, Healing, Protection, and Optimization), Quality of Service (QoS), Home Automation, Opening to third-party services, and Green attitude. The work presented here focuses on the QoS challenge. It is conducted in a research project that focuses on the QoS maintenance of services offered to end-users via their DH. QoS maintenance requires QoS monitoring and analyzing mechanisms. As a consequence, we propose a QoS Monitoring and Analyzing enabler that uses the Service Level Checking approach (SLC) to analyze the DH´s QoS with regard to services contracts (i.e., Service Level Agreement: SLA). SLC refers to issues and solutions related to the services compliance analyzing/checking w.r.t. their SLA. SLC takes as input monitoring information related to the services, and SLA contractualizing the services, it then analyzes these inputs and produces results about the services´ compliance. In the DH context, a service can be an end-user or a software service, a network link, or a device. This paper presents our solution, named SLC4DH, which has been implemented and validated in our research project.
